Peterborough City Council explains £900 bill for 'fish and chips'

Council officers said the £900 charge was for hiring the Marigold Tavern as a polling station, not a meal, after a resident questioned 16 card payments.

A bill for £900 seemingly spent on ‘fish and chips’ by a council officer has been clarified by a leading Peterborough councillor.
